The modern Russian T-90M «Proryv» tank has a number of advantages over older units, such as the T-80. This was stated by tank company gunner-operator Maxim Manoilov.
According to him, the key differences lie in the thermal sight and firing. The Proryv's rangefinder works more accurately.
In addition, in a more modern version of the equipment, the commander has a duplicate command, which allows him to also fire from the combat vehicle.
More buttons on the T-90M «Proryv»
Yes, there are more buttons, the loading machines are different. The sight is different, unlike the «eighty», the all-round visibility is greater. Visibility is many times better.
At the same time, retraining and mastering the control of the T-90M is not difficult for military personnel, since both tanks are produced according to a similar system.
